What Is Varithena Sclerotherapy? An Overview
Varithena sclerotherapy is a cutting-edge vein treatment that utilizes a specialized foam sclerosant designed to safely and efficiently close problematic veins. Unlike traditional varicose vein treatments, such as surgical removal, varithena offers a minimally invasive procedure conducted in a doctor’s office with minimal downtime. The unique formulation of the varithena product allows for effective vein closure, leading to the resolution of unsightly surface veins and alleviation of associated symptoms.
The Science Behind Varithena Sclerotherapy
The core principle of varithena sclerotherapy involves injecting a foam sclerosant into targeted veins. This foam displaces blood within the vein, causing irritation of the vessel walls, which prompts the body’s natural healing response. The affected vein gradually shrinks, scars down, and ultimately disappears. The innovative foam formulation, in contrast to liquid sclerosants, offers several advantages:
- Enhanced contact time with the vein walls for effective closure
- Better dosing precision and control
- Improved efficacy in larger or complicated veins
This technology combines the safety and effectiveness necessary for optimal vein treatment outcomes, ensuring patients experience significant improvement both cosmetically and functionally.

Who Are Ideal Candidates for Varithena Sclerotherapy?
Ideal candidates are individuals with:
- Visible varicose veins or spider veins causing cosmetic concerns
- Chronic venous insufficiency symptoms, such as aching, throbbing, or heaviness in the legs
- Vein-related skin changes like pigmentation or eczema
- Refractory symptoms after conservative methods, including compression stockings and lifestyle modifications
It is essential to consult with a qualified vascular specialist who can evaluate your vascular condition, perform diagnostic tests such as duplex ultrasound, and determine if varithena sclerotherapy is appropriate for your specific needs.
The Procedure: What to Expect with varithena sclerotherapy
Pre-Procedure Preparation
Prior to treatment, your vascular specialist will review your medical history, perform a physical examination, and conduct duplex ultrasound imaging to identify the problematic veins' size, location, and flow. Patients are advised to:
- Wear comfortable, loose clothing
- Avoid applying lotions or lotions on the treatment area
- Follow any specific instructions regarding medications, such as blood thinners
The Day of Treatment
During the procedure:
- The patient lies comfortably on a treatment table
- The physician administers a local anesthetic to minimize discomfort
- Using ultrasound guidance, the doctor precisely injects the varithena foam sclerosant into targeted veins
- The entire process generally takes about 30-45 minutes depending on the number and size of treated veins
Post-Procedure Care
After treatment, patients are usually advised to:
- Wear compression stockings for several days to weeks to support vein healing
- Engage in light walking to promote circulation
- Avoid strenuous activities for a few days
- Attend follow-up visits for evaluation and additional treatments if necessary
Most side effects are minor, including mild bruising, redness, or swelling, which resolve quickly.
Long-Term Outcomes and Follow-Up
Studies and clinical experiences consistently demonstrate that varithena sclerotherapy offers durable results, with many patients experiencing a significant reduction in vein visibility and symptoms for years post-treatment. Follow-up ultrasound assessments help confirm vein closure, and additional sessions may be scheduled for remaining or new veins. Proper post-treatment care and lifestyle modifications, such as maintaining a healthy weight and avoiding prolonged standing, can enhance the longevity of treatment results.
